Created during a live demonstration at SiNaCa Studios’ November 2019 Open Studios, Acorn #3 is an early and foundational piece in Clifton Crofford’s current body of work. Created using a “waste mold” technique inspired by bronze foundry processes, the sculpture began with molds of human hands—specifically, those of Clifton’s daughter Eleanor. These molds were modeled in wax, cast into ceramic shell blow molds, and used to shape the glass in a single-use process. The result is a striking, organic form that blends symbolism, texture, and technical mastery.
The acorn represents renewal and the infinite potential held within each seed. The inclusion of human hands speaks to the essential role of community in cultivating ideas and growth. This piece also served as the narrative foundation for Clifton’s Fort Worth Public Art Project, The Seeds of a New Season, located on Magnolia Avenue.
Clifton Crofford’s passion for glass began at UT Arlington, where he explored design through architecture, theater, and art. After helping develop a new 3D art facility, he co-founded a glassblowing studio in Dallas/Fort Worth. In 2007, Clifton and fellow alumni established SiNaCa Studios, which opened to the public in 2010. His work blends ancient and modern symbols, exploring themes of balance, growth, and transformation. Through glass, Clifton invites viewers to pause, reflect, and connect.
